 So, did I get to see all the above said similarities at the Adam Lambert showcase? The answer is one out of three. Yes, we, to our screaming delight, all got hear that signature high power-pack voice that is Adam; singing 5 songs from his debut album. My favourites had to be the encore Down the Rabbit Hole and Whataya Want from Me plus 1 song from his American Idol glory days Mad World. I do wish that more of his songs from his album were as good as Mad World… but hey, it’s just his first album right? Did we get to see the glitz, shing and the bling with the sequins and the feathers? Unfortunately no, because Adam did an acoustic version of all his songs with just his talented guitarist and drummer, sitting on a high stool. The good thing is we got to hear more of his wonderful voice unmarred by big rock band sounds, which ironically would be the very thing to bring his fans to their feet. And that, to me, is the signature Adam Lambert showmanship! Alas, it was meant to be just a simple showcase with a humble set-up and we all saw a somewhat subdued Adam, minus all his onstage antics. 

ADAM LAMBERT SHOWCASE ( PHOTO COURTESY OF SONY MUSIC SINGAPORE) That said, Adam did promise that the next time he is here in Singapore for his super -loud, screaming fans (and believe you me, there were many that night. Me included!) he will spare no expense in bringing on all the glitz, shing and  bling with  sequins and the feathers. Plus, a big rock band at a bigger venue! And his great sense of humour!
